Membre dévoué

Inscrit le :09/06/2022
Dernière activité :16/02/2026 à 15:44
Version d'Excel :365 & 2016 FR
Emploi :Technicien BE/Methodes
Lieu :Nantes
Biographie :Il descendit sur terre, tel le Messie, dans les années 90. Depuis le monde a changé :D
Messages
605
Votes
203
Fichiers
0
Téléchargements
0
SujetsMessagesStatistiquesVotes reçus

Messages postés par Geof52 - page 10

DateAuteur du sujetSujetExtrait du message
12/04/2023 à 07:47winnythepooh Finaliser formulaire RoulageAlors je n'ai peut-etre pas compris l'utilisation mais quelques trucs qui me disait que c'était bizarre: Je n'ai pas regardé l'enssemble de ta macro mais dans ton exemple ça ne fonctionnait pas également. Exemple de coquille : 1 - Le bouton enregistrer n'est pas celui que tu as mis dans la macro. bt...
11/04/2023 à 15:47medsoft313Format cellule Gras VBATraduction de ta Macro : Quand la selection de la cellule change, si cette cellule est en E20:E48 ; La cellule selectionnée est en gras Prends la propriété "Gras" de cette cellule et fait le contraire (enleve ou mets la propriété gras suivant son état actuel). => donc tu fais et annule l'action a...
11/04/2023 à 12:21winnythepooh Finaliser formulaire RoulageUne façon de faire : A l'ouverture, j'ai laissé un message "oui / non" pour faciliter le développement. Une fois le fichier finalisé laisse seulement "Ouverture_UserformSeul" dans "Workbook_Open". J'ai ajouté une partie dans le module1 et a l'interieur de ton userform l'initialisation (j'ai mis "Geo...
11/04/2023 à 08:50Jerem_74dJalon sur un diagramme de GANTTTu dois modifier la mise en forme conditionnelle ("s'applique à") et y ajouter ta zone de tableau. A+...
07/04/2023 à 13:52Jerem_74dJalon sur un diagramme de GANTTTu es parti d'un modele de Gantt simple, tu devrais voir ce que fait le modele Agile et t'en inspirer. Pour les petits drapeau regarde juste la mise en forme conditionnelle. A+...
04/04/2023 à 12:15LoOXX Somme pondérée de "Oui/Non"Un mélange de nb.si et nbval ? renvoyant vrai ou faux ...
03/04/2023 à 11:21LemployéDuMois Soustraire deux horaires sans VBALe 1 est considéré comme 1 jour donc divise le par 24 pour qu'il soit = a 1h et par 48 pour 30 min et un "si" cette formule est négatif, on affiche rien. A+...
31/03/2023 à 15:10PatPatrouille TextBox en lettres rougesParfait, tu peux déja sortir les glaçons j'arrive...
31/03/2023 à 14:57PatPatrouille TextBox en lettres rougesEffectivement, on va trouver Tu as essayé TextBoxNUMLIM.enabled = true ? A ma connaissance pas possible de changer la couleur d'un textbox verrouillé. Essai de changer Locked avec un Si plutot que de mettre Enabled...
31/03/2023 à 14:36PatPatrouille TextBox en lettres rougesAlors l'action se fera si le texte dans TextBoxNUMLIM change car : Si une fois le texte changé le nombre de caractere est différent de 1 alors ce texte est rouge. Pour moi si c'est encor Gris soit : Tu ne changes pas le texte et du coup la procedure ne se lance pas soit : ce que tu as ecrit a 1 seul...
31/03/2023 à 14:07PatPatrouille TextBox en lettres rougesTon End if ne sert a rien car le resultat de ton if est juste derriere Then: Ta couleur n'est pas le soucis ici. (enfin le "Len" compte le nombre de caractere donc ne sera jamais égal a "Attention !") A+...
31/03/2023 à 13:15laura60680 Excel formule arrondis notesOui, cette formule arrondi au multiple de 0.5 donc : Moins de 0.25 = 0 de 0.25 à 0.75 = 0.5 0.75 ou Plus = 1 A+...
31/03/2023 à 12:17laura60680 Excel formule arrondis notesIl n'y a pas un soucis dans ton exemple ?, pourquoi le 11.19 est arrondi inferieur et le 11.53 est un arrondi superieur ? Si le 11.53 doit devenir un 11.50 il faut utiliser (en I3)...
31/03/2023 à 11:32aureliehFormule "nombre de cellules remplies"En AI2 = +Mise en forme conditionnelle pour les couleurs. A+...
30/03/2023 à 12:05Gael0108Aide création formuleJe te propose un moyen de "tricher", je ne sais pas si c'est possible autrement. Une autre feuillle recherche ta futur liste déroulante par nom et c'est cette liste que tu viens selectionner dans tes besoins. Si il y a une autre méthode proposée, (peut-etre avec power query) oublie celle là. A+...
30/03/2023 à 10:07P4TQuand "convertir" modifie les données (WTF ?)En selectionnant Texte apres avoir selectionné la colonne ? Je trouves 1810119151935427 moi avec cette methode Je n'ai jamais eu de soucis de remplacement par des 0...
30/03/2023 à 10:01P4TQuand "convertir" modifie les données (WTF ?)Boujour, Il suffit d'identifier ta colonne comme du texte, car a plus de 15 caractere (en nombre) Excel remplace les derniers par des 0. A+...
29/03/2023 à 20:07capucine Disabler des boutons de UserFormLe TabStop c'est passe d'un objet a un autre qui est en "True" avec la touche tabulation. L'ordre de passage d'un objet a un autre est la propriété "TabIndex" qui s'incrémente a chaque nouvel objet mais qui peut etre modifiable...
29/03/2023 à 20:02stage.empFormule pour copier des informations entre feuilles, sans macrosBonjour ? La seule façon que je vois sans passer par une macro et garder les remplissages de cellules pour chaque prénom, c'est : 1 - copie de ton planning general sur les autres feuilles pour coller la mise en forme 2 - étirer les formules ligne 2 des feuilles de chaque intervenant jusqu'a la fin d...
29/03/2023 à 17:50capucine Disabler des boutons de UserFormJ'utilise Userform.show 0/1 mais c'est la meme chose que False du coup (je pensais que tu souihaitais fermer/masquer l'userform) J'ai mis en commentaire cette partie (donc le initialize est "vide") et je n'ai donc aucune de ces 3 lignes Et j'ai ce message (quand les propriétés TabStop sont False sur...
29/03/2023 à 15:34Samy.stkAjout d'une condition SI pour un formulaireJe rejoins également Cylfo concernant les cellules fusionnées et qui vont te poser probleme pour l'envoi du mail (a ma connaissance). Ou il faut générer un fichier pdf / Excel avec les donnnées souhaitées et c'est ce fichier qu'il faut envoyer en piece jointe. Tu devrais pouvoir t'inspirer du fichie...
29/03/2023 à 15:00capucine Disabler des boutons de UserFormJe ne me suis jamais servi d'un UserForm pour VLC, je sais pas si je peux t'aider la dessus. Mais tu peux tester quelques trucs : 1 - Changer l'ordre de 2 - Tu es sûr de "UserForm4.show false" ? et pas un "Userform4.Hide" ou "Unload UserForm4" ...
29/03/2023 à 14:16capucine Disabler des boutons de UserFormRe, Tu as la possibilité de partager le fichier sans info personnelle ? Pour ensuite desactiver les objets, je trouves deja ça louche. Edit : Essai d'inverser les deux lignes...
29/03/2023 à 11:19lea3014 Afficher les lignes d'un tableau en fonction d'une donnée spécifiqueA oui Exact Puisque la deuxieme partie de la macro detect si CA1 est dans CA18. (CA1 + suffixe 8) tu peux ajouter une "virgule" a ce niveau la Puisque dans le NumCA les données seront toujours le CA recherché suivi d'une vigule et un espace) A+...
29/03/2023 à 10:40camalexis Restituer valeurs chexbox (caption) dans différentes cellules@Dan Exact, Pour les boucles, je ne m'en sert pas souvent entre plusieurs objets mais ça peut etre bien pratique surtout avec la propriété Tag que je n'utilisais pas non plus. Pour le Controltiptext, je ne suis pas fan de cette propriété qui pour moi "polue" l' Userform. Merci, j'ajoute ceci a ma pe...
29/03/2023 à 10:12lea3014 Afficher les lignes d'un tableau en fonction d'une donnée spécifiqueAlors voila une façon de faire avec pratiquement la même methode que le dernier filtre. On trouve le texte a chercher et on met dans une variable son CA qui lui est lié. Puis on regarde toutes les lignes et si elles n'ont pas leurs CA dans cette variable, la ligne est masquée. A+...
29/03/2023 à 08:40Snowkite Export onglet en PDF et renommer le PDF avec le nom de l'ongletOui c'est possible si tu mets une variable exemple NomOnglet =ActiveSheet.Name Et tu changes Fich = "TR_" & ".pdf" en Fich = "TR_" & NomOnglet & ".pdf" A+...
29/03/2023 à 07:28capucine Disabler des boutons de UserFormSans le fichier pour vérifier si dans ta procedure il n'y a pas une contradiction, je miserai sur : Tes objets ne doivent pas savoir sur quel UserForm ils sont. Test comme ça ? A+...
29/03/2023 à 07:12sebmika974 Attribuer note aux personnes en fonctions de la valeur d'une autre celluleOui, tu peux changer la largeur des colonnes. Quand tu selectionne la ListeBoxTache dans l'Userform, tu as les propriétés (touche [F4]) Column Count pour le nombre de colonne (si tu veux repasser a 1) et Column Widths pour la largeur des colonnes. Changes le 220 en 350 par exemple et tu aura...
29/03/2023 à 00:00sebmika974 Attribuer note aux personnes en fonctions de la valeur d'une autre celluleBonsoir / Bonjour, Une petite contribution, le gain de temps n'est pas fou mais c'etait sympa a faire. Utilisation : Tu passe sur tous les Agents 1 par 1 sur grace aux fleches en haut a droite. Tu sélectionnes les taches que l'agent maitrise (Expert / confirmé / Interdiaire / Debutant) Tu vois le ni...
28/03/2023 à 21:52Samy.stkAjout d'une condition SI pour un formulaireJ'ai refait la macro Enregistrer a partir de ce que tu as fait grace a l'enregistrement automatique (Toujours en Module1). Ca doit être un peu plus simple a comprendre. A+...
28/03/2023 à 19:52lea3014 Afficher les lignes d'un tableau en fonction d'une donnée spécifiqueSuivant ton exemple, "100192" doit être filtré avec le CA5. Mais que dois faire la macro si la valeur cherché n'est pas trouvé ? Ou si elle est trouvé sur plusieurs CA comme c'est le cas ici : Il y aura donc le CA4 + CA5 + CA6 de filtré ? et donc du coup pas comme ton exemple ? Ou il y a le texte ch...
28/03/2023 à 19:28camalexis Restituer valeurs chexbox (caption) dans différentes cellulesSi j'ai bien compris, les problemes sont : - L'incrementation des checkboxs les checkboxs en colonne T X et AM - Les checkboxs restent cochées d'une personne a une autre (la liste en colonne AK également). - Et les checkboxs ne recuperent pas les infos renseignées quand tu modifie le formulaire d'un...
28/03/2023 à 17:22stage.empFormule pour copier des informations entre feuilles, sans macrosBonjour ? Oui, sans macro tu devrais pouvoir avec au minimum : https://www.excel-pratique.com/fr/formation-excel/fonction-si https://www.excel-pratique.com/fr/fonctions/recherchev https://www.excel-pratique.com/fr/formation-excel/mise-en-forme-conditionnelle Avec Ella qui se retrouve dans la feuille...
28/03/2023 à 15:21lea3014 Afficher les lignes d'un tableau en fonction d'une donnée spécifiqueSuite au fichier déja envoyé, tu trouveras un nouveau module Filtre (bouton + affichage ligne) mais concernant le fichier de JFL, je ne peux pas repondre n'ayant pas (Excel 365) A+ Edit : 2eme fois avec trop de retard, *Petite contribution*...
28/03/2023 à 10:49lea3014 Afficher les lignes d'un tableau en fonction d'une donnée spécifiqueUn exemple de ce qui peut etre fait "facilement" grace aux cours VBA que tu peux trouver en haut de la page avec un peu d'enregistrement de macro. A+ Edit: pas assez rapide, Bonjour JFL...
24/03/2023 à 13:16Chnico80Boite de dialogue suivant date et récupération de donnéesUn exemple : j'ai rajouté des lignes avec la date du jour pour les lister. A+ Edit : pas assez rapide et petite erreur, j'ai mis "<" au lieu de "<=". Bonjour Bruno...
23/03/2023 à 18:35franciskamanMise en forme conditionnelleUne façon de faire: A+...
23/03/2023 à 17:46Azraelle81 Sélectionner une page en VBAC'est plutot : si la cellule contient "Soltis" ( avec les * qui peuvent contenir les prefixes / sufixes du mot recherché)...
23/03/2023 à 16:48Azraelle81 Sélectionner une page en VBAUne façon de faire : Vu que tes données sur les deux feuilles (Soltis et Autre tissu sont les mêmes plages). Je test en premier si Soltis est en Feille Saisie "matériel" Si c'est le cas la feuille Plan Soltis est utilisé sinon c'est l'autre. A+...
23/03/2023 à 12:13InvitéCréation d'un bouton générant une FEUILLE VIERGE à partir dune feuille mèreOui, dans la feuil1 la macro lié au bouton est : Tu peux mettre un "apostrophe" devant la ligne masquer la base (modele) pour desactiver cette ligne...
23/03/2023 à 11:43InvitéCréation d'un bouton générant une FEUILLE VIERGE à partir dune feuille mèreJ'ai mis un bouton avec un petit +, Il copie la feuille modele pour la coller juste apres (donc la plus recente feuille copié sera la plus visible) puis masque le modele (pour eviter d'y mettre des données non souhaité). Ce bouton ouvre un userform qui y indique le jour d'aujourd'hui (que l'on peut...
22/03/2023 à 17:08slyganErreur 1004 classeur partagéCe n'est pas un code que j'ai donné mais identifier un soucis dans ton code puisque le fichier a ouvrir, n'est pas disponible pour les utilisateurs alors comment la macro pourrait l'ouvrir ...
22/03/2023 à 13:34zinelamri Afficher/Masquer des lignes en fonction d'une celulleEffectivement, c'etait un "si.condition" je n'ai pas fait attention a ta version de Office. C'est corrigé (avec une imbrication de SI) A+...
22/03/2023 à 12:06Jade MioCréation de plusieurs IF pour créer une variableAlors pour commencer, tu peux jeter un oeil sur les cours VBA en haut de l'ecran, c'est une mine d'or https://www.excel-pratique.com/fr/vba Pour ce qui est de le macro, Range correspond aux cellules. J'imagine que "QC00141_new" doit etre pour passer de la ligne 1 a la 2 puis 3 , .... ? (puisque tu p...
22/03/2023 à 11:28VengeurMasqué Compter plusieurs nom+prénom dans cellulesPour la formule que tu utilise, je pense que tu n'as pas totalement compris ce qu'elle fait. NBCAR($C9) -------> Prend les caracteres de la cellule -NBCAR(SUBSTITUE($C9;",";"")) -------> Prend les caracteres de la cellule une fois les "," effacées +1 -------> car dans la cellule, tu as touj...
22/03/2023 à 08:35VengeurMasqué Compter plusieurs nom+prénom dans cellulesJe suis d'accord avec h2so4 quitte a faire un onglet masqué. Pour ta premiere formule c'est normal l'erreur puisque tes donnees sont dans D et que tes formules sont sur B. en G9 =SI($C9="";"0";(NBCAR($C9)-NBCAR(SUBSTITUE($C9;",";""))+1))+SI($D9="";"0";(NBCAR($D9)-NBCAR(SUBSTITUE($D9;",";""))+1)) Com...
21/03/2023 à 16:35slyganErreur 1004 classeur partagéPour moi, vite fait sans trop chercher, je mise sur : Cette partie pas accessible a tous ...
21/03/2023 à 12:01dav43 Code pour changer la couleur du texte d'une colonne ListviewSympa le fichier, une solution possible en 3 lignes sur une boucle. Dans la procedure Listviewfi j'ai mis en commentaire tes 2 lignes et rajouté ça : Edit : J'ai passé trop vite sur ce que tu souhaites faire en colonne A donc : le code au dessus tu as juste "Plein" la colonne A en rouge et ce code e...
21/03/2023 à 10:02dav43 Code pour changer la couleur du texte d'une colonne ListviewSi ton probleme n'est pas résolu, aucune raison de clore le sujet. Tu peux partager un exemple de ton fichier sans info confidentielle ? Ou refaire un fichier vierge avec quelques lignes dans ta listview pour pouvoir tester...